Match Toffee Orange

Benjamin Moore Toffee Orange is a mid-tone shade, warm in character with an LRV of 49. The matches below are ranked by ΔE, a perceptual color-difference score.

Closest matches across every brand

One match per brand, ranked by ΔE — a perceptual color difference score calculated from Lab color space values. Lower is closer. Click any card to compare side by side in simulated rooms.
